I will carefully pack it for shipping. 【Product Description】 "What time is it?" When you look at the clock, a naan with a relaxed form will tell you the time. Its name is "Ima Nanji" (What Time Is It?). It doesn't have a dial, and it only tells you the approximate time, which is even more "nanji" (what time). Without being too concerned with the details, and with a general sense of time, I want to live a relaxed and leisurely life, like the relaxed form of naan. This work was born from that feeling. Of course, the naan itself is real naan. Therefore, each one has a different baking color and expression. * The naan production is done in cooperation with the Nepalese curry restaurant "Art and Nepal" in Amagasaki, Hyogo Prefecture. Art and Nepal is a unique curry restaurant that also engages in various art activities while serving delicious curry. 【More Detailed Information】 This was inspired by Salvador Dalí's masterpiece, "The Persistence of Memory," also known as "Soft Watches." He is said to have depicted the image of past time becoming vague and melting away in memory as "soft watches." "Ima Nanji" questions the busy days of being chased by time, from the contradiction that arises by intentionally making the "measuring stick of time," the clock, ambiguous.
